Tapping the Power of FamilySearch with Maureen Brady – Virtual Only

November 21, 2024 @ 10:00 am - 11:30 am EST

Join us along with Maureen Brady, a member of LDS as she presents her topic in a LIVE presentation “Tapping the Power of FamilySearch.”  FamilySearch®, a free website sponsored by The Church of Jesus Christ of Latter-Day Saints, provides family history researchers with access to original historical records from around the world, indexes linked directly to many of those records, an ever-growing genealogical “encyclopedia”, instructional videos and much more.  Even experienced researchers often do not know how to tap the power of FamilySearch’s many databases and articles.  This presentation will provide a “tour” of the website and suggest search strategies for locating the historical records.  Speaker will be remote.

Maureen Brady, a former school librarian and computer educator with 30 years experience in family history research is our November speaker. She is a member of the Genealogical Speakers Guild, the Association of Professional Genealogists and many other societies. She will present in a live demonstration the many features on FamilySearch that are unknown and underused by family researchers. Visit Maureen at her website: https://chitownroots.com/
